The Emeralds were established in 1955 as a charter member of the Northwest League, the same circuit that they compete within today. The Ems returned to the Northwest League five years later when the PCL moved the AAA team to Sacramento for the 1974 season,[18] while the Phillies moved their AAA farm team to the Toledo Mud Hens of the International League. The Emeralds returned to the Northwest League in 1975, affiliating with Cincinnati (1975-'83), Kansas City (1984-'94), Atlanta (1995-'98), the Chicago Cubs (1999-2000; 2015-'20), San Diego (2001-'14) and, finally, San Francisco.
